Lifecycle Messaging

  • Lifecycle Messaging’s mission is to create and deliver scaled, customer centric multi-channel messaging experiences across the customer journey that drive impact in the form of engagement, revenue growth, customer delight & brand trust. Our platform, the Unified Messaging Platform helps us to inform, engage, and delight our guests.

Job Summary:

  • Design and implement tier-1 microservices in Java
  • Design core, backend software components for the Unified Messaging Platform
  • Implement asynchronous processes to run in the cloud for various data transformation operations.
  • Work on tech design for various initiatives and projects as per business needs.
  • Be involved in code reviews and architecture reviews for team members.
  • Participate in Agile methodology and SCRUM processes such as Sprint Planning, Backlog grooming, Daily Standups, and Retrospectives with the team.
  • Provide on-call support for critical services on a rotational basis.
  • Own features/functionality and deliver projects end-to-end with high quality and robust architecture.
  • Communicate and work with multi-functional business partners.
  • Ramp up on new domains and technologies.

Responsibilities and Duties of the Role:

Lead the design & enhancement of critical services in UMP, ensuring scalability, performance, and reliability. Research and integrate new technologies into the production environment to optimize core service offerings.

Promote and support Agile methodologies such as Scrum, Kanban, and Scrumban by actively participating in regular ceremonies such as stand-up, retrospectives and sprint planning.

Provide technical guidance to junior team members, covering code quality, system design, and best practices in software development. Actively participate in code reviews, offering constructive feedback to improve code quality, system reliability, and performance

Collaborate with your squad, Product Managers, Designers, QA, Operations, and other stakeholders to understand requirements and articulate technical decisions and outcomes.

Basic Qualifications:

  • 5+ years of experience building internet-scale web or services applications
  • Experience in a Java and/or alternative JVM application development environments (Scala/Kotlin)
  • Familiarity with the AWS environment (awareness of ECS (Docker), S3, EC2, Lambda, CloudWatch, etc)
  • Solid understanding with software development fundamentals
  • Proficiency with writing unit, integration and functional tests
  • Experience with Relational and NoSQL Databases like Postgres, MySql, DynamoDB, Cassandra
  • Proficiency with standard CI/CD procedures & tools like Jenkins, Github Actions, Spinnaker
  • Familiarity with service APIs and/or SDKs
  • Understanding of agile processes, software version control & project management tools (e.g. Github, SVN, Jira, Basecamp)

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Experience or certification with AWS services, including S3, SQS, SNS, Kinesis, Lambda, CloudWatch, or other cloud platforms (Azure, GCP)
  • Familiarity with big data technologies & tools like Spark, Databricks, EMR
  • Familiarity with Terraform or other infrastructure as code tooling
  • Experience building scalable, fault-tolerant, high-uptime systems
  • Creative and inventive problem solving
  • Desire and initiative to mentor other developers

Bonus Qualifications:

  • Experience with SES or Salesforce Marketing Cloud
  • Experience with Serverless solutions
  • Familiarity with the Scala programming language and the Python programming language

Required Education: 

  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, Software, Electrical or Electronics Engineering, or comparable field of study, and/or equivalent work experience.
The hiring range for this position in Los Angeles is $141,900 to $181,200 per year. The base pay actually offered will take into account internal equity and also may vary depending on the candidate’s geographic region, job-related knowledge, skills, and experience among other factors. A bonus and/or long-term incentive units may be provided as part of the compensation package, in addition to the full range of medical, financial, and/or other benefits, dependent on the level and position offered.
